Magnesium Hydroxide Dosing

Magnesium Hydroxide is commonly used in sewage systems for pH adjusment (acid neutralisation), coagulation and odour control. Being an alkali, it is commonly used in sewage systems where low pH is a known issue.

At lower pH levels (pH <6), the predominant sulphide species in septic sewer is H2S which is highly volatile and likely to be released downstream as a gas. As the pH level is increased, the sulphide species change to become predominantly HS-.. At a pH of 8-9, the predominant sulphide species is HS- which is relatively stable and more likely to remain in solution.

This pH adjustment can result in a dramatic reduction in odour release from the site as well as a reduction in damaging corrosion on the infrastructure. Some other benefits of Magnesium Hydroxide dosing are:

  • Naturally buffers at pH 9.5
  • Non-hazardous
  • Can be dosed automatically
  • Friendly to biological systems
